让我难过的XML问题,但可能非常简单...XML是这样的:16Sep2009Jeztexttextnumber1HighStUKtextnumbertextHouse21textlong-text80sq.mtNoOfBedrooms:2Condition:HabitableLandSize(M2):2,000URLURLURLURLtexturltexturl我想使用的代码是:SetNodeList=objXML.documentElement.selectNodes("agents/agent/properties/property")ForEachNodeInNodeList'I
您好,我正在尝试使用xpath读取我的xml文档。我已经用了几个星期了,只是学习XML和VB,但似乎遇到了障碍。我尝试了几次不同的尝试,并且使用xpathnavigator类在网页上显示XML文件没有问题。但后来我需要格式化成一个html表,所以我采取了另一条路线,只是添加了带有formview的xmldatasource。所以这是我的代码2011/02/0816:39:016200我想获取的值是本例中的日期“2011/02/0816:39:01”和数字“6”以及持续时间“200”不确定我做错了什么,如果我使用'/>这给了我“GiftShopTime”但不是实际时间。另外,如果我只是使
我正在制作一个web应用程序,其中的页面是xml,它们使用xslt样式表来创建xhtml输出。因此许多页面布局将包含在XSLT样式表中,从某种意义上说,XSLT表包含有关页面布局的所有公共(public)信息,是否可以为xslt创建一个asp.net母版页床单??基本上我会有一个生成xml的aspx页面,并包括另一个aspx页面,这是一个xslt工作表,使用母版页插入页面上的任何内容更改[仅限中间Pane]。此外,您认为这是一个好的设计策略吗? 最佳答案 这就是我所说的“填空”技术,是的,这是一个非常好的设计模式,它允许将表示和处理
专家!我对XML很陌生。但是,webapp以XML形式收集数据,我必须在ASP.NetGridView中显示它(并启用编辑)。我需要你的帮助。4444testpatientblahblahxxxxNegative1111Positivedx 最佳答案 我能想到的将XML绑定(bind)到gridview的最简单方法是将xml加载到DataSet,然后将DataSet绑定(bind)到gridview:StringReadersr=newStringReader(xml);DataSetds=newDataSet();ds.ReadX
我有以下类(class):[XmlElement("email-address")]publicclassEmailAddress{publicstringaddress{get;set;}publicstringlocation{get;set;}}XmlElement属性在这里有效,但我确实想要这种行为-这可能吗?要将此类的名称在XML中序列化为email-address而不是EmailAddress? 最佳答案 我认为您正在寻找XmlTypeAttribute如果您想更改类的序列化方式。
您是如何让ASP.NET输出UTF-16编码文本的?我在.NET中序列化了一个默认为UTF-16格式的对象。现在我想将字符串作为对.ashx请求的输出响应发送。我得到错误:不支持从当前编码切换到指定编码。错误处理资源如何让我的网站或页面使用UTF-16格式。谢谢。更新:阅读两个答案。 最佳答案 一般来说:不要。作为UTF-16的网页混淆了许多工具,并使浏览器以奇怪的、意想不到的方式运行。(例如:链接脚本、表单提交、代理)。UTF-16只能作为二进制对象安全提供,因此对于Web内容,请坚持使用ASCII超集的编码-显而易见的选择是UT
princeuser1这是我的xml文件名user.xml。现在,当我单击页面中的按钮时,我需要从该文件中获取数据并将该数据放入变量中,例如:stringstrusername=datacmgfromxmlfile(prince)stringstrPassword=datacmgfromxmlfile(password)谁能告诉我如何用语法做到这一点?谢谢 最佳答案 LINQtoXML是做你想做的事的现代方式。XDocumentxDoc=XDocument.Load("user.xml");stringstrusername=xDo
我需要在这里创建一个xml文件boolresult=false;如何使用C#语法在ASP.NET中实现此目的。result是我需要添加到XML文件中的值。我需要在包含如下内容的文件夹下创建一个XML文件yes谢谢 最佳答案 XElementxml=newXElement("user",newXElement("Authenticated","Yes")));xml.Save(savePath);它适用于.net3及更高版本,但以后的版本可以使用XmlDocumentXmlDocumentxmlDoc=newXmlDocument()
我正在显示异步加载数据的图表,因为搜索是获取数据的工作量很大。数据必须以XML形式返回,以使图表库满意。我的ActionMethods返回类型设置为文本/xml的ContentResult。我使用LinqtoXML构建我的Xml并调用ToString。这工作正常,但测试起来并不理想。我有另一个实现此目的的想法,即返回一个使用XSLTView引擎构建我的XML的View。我很好奇,我总是尝试以“正确的方式”做事。那么你们是如何处理这种情况的呢?您是实现不同的ViewEngine(如xslt)来构建您的XML,还是在您的Controller(或为您的Controller提供服务的服务)内构
我有一个Select查询,它从表中选择前10个值Createproc[dbo].[SP_Select_Top10]asselectDISTINCTtop(10)Score,FBidfromFB_PlayerORDERBYScoreDESC我需要的是将此查询的结果保存在xml文件中。我使用ASP.NET创建这个文件,我该怎么做? 最佳答案 像这样创建存储过程-使用FORXMLPATH(),ROOT()语法让SQLServer为您生成适当的XML:CREATEPROCEDUREdbo.procGetPlayerScoreASBEGINS